§ 77-30-10 — Time to apply for habeas corpus allowed.
No person arrested upon such warrant shall be delivered over to the agent whom the executive authority demanding the arrested person shall have appointed to receive the arrested person unless the arrested person shall first be taken forthwith before a judge of a court of record in this state who shall inform the arrested person of the demand made for the arrested person's surrender and of the crime with which the arrested person is charged and that the arrested person has the right to demand and procure legal counsel and if the prisoner or the prisoner's counsel shall state that the prisoner or the prisoner's counsel desires to test the legality of the prisoner's arrest, the judge of such court of record shall fix a reasonable time to be allowed the prisoner within which to apply for a wr
